DOCUMENTATION = '''
---
module: azure_rm_virtualmachineimage_facts
version_added: "2.1"
short_description: Get virtual machine image facts.
description:
- Get facts for virtual machine images.
options:
name:
description:
- Only show results for a specific security group.
default: null
required: false
location:
description:
- Azure location value (ie. westus, eastus, eastus2, northcentralus, etc.). Supplying only a
location value will yield a list of available publishers for the location.
required: true
publisher:
description:
- Name of an image publisher. List image offerings associated with a particular publisher.
default: null
required: false
offer:
description:
- Name of an image offering. Combine with sku to see a list of available image versions.
default: null
required: false
sku:
description:
- Image offering SKU. Combine with offer to see a list of available versions.
default: null
required: false
version:
description:
- Specific version number of an image.
default: null
required: false
extends_documentation_fragment:
- azure
author:
- "Chris Houseknecht (@chouseknecht)"
- "Matt Davis (@nitzmahone)"
'''
EXAMPLES = '''
- name: Get facts for a specific image
azure_rm_virtualmachineimage_facts:
location: eastus
publisher: OpenLogic
offer: CentOS
sku: '7.1'
version: '7.1.20160308'
- name: List available versions
azure_rm_virtualmachineimage_facts:
location: eastus
publisher: OpenLogic
offer: CentOS
sku: '7.1'
- name: List available offers
azure_rm_virtualmachineimage_facts:
location: eastus
publisher: OpenLogic
- name: List available publishers
azure_rm_virtualmachineimage_facts:
location: eastus
'''
RETURN = '''
azure_vmimages:
description: List of image dicts.
returned: always
type: list
example: []
'''
from ansible.module_utils.basic import *
from ansible.module_utils.azure_rm_common import *
try:
from msrestazure.azure_exceptions import CloudError
from azure.common import AzureMissingResourceHttpError, AzureHttpError
except:
# This is handled in azure_rm_common
pass
AZURE_ENUM_MODULES = ['azure.mgmt.compute.models.compute_management_client_enums']
class AzureRMVirtualMachineImageFacts(AzureRMModuleBase):
def __init__(self, **kwargs):
self.module_arg_spec = dict(
location=dict(type='str', required=True),
publisher=dict(type='str'),
offer=dict(type='str'),
sku=dict(type='str'),
version=dict(type='str')
)
self.results = dict(
changed=False,
ansible_facts=dict(azure_vmimages=[])
)
self.location = None
self.publisher = None
self.offer = None
self.sku = None
self.version = None
super(AzureRMVirtualMachineImageFacts, self).__init__(self.module_arg_spec)
def exec_module(self, **kwargs):
for key in self.module_arg_spec:
setattr(self, key, kwargs[key])
if self.location and self.publisher and self.offer and self.sku and self.version:
self.results['ansible_facts']['azure_vmimages'] = self.get_item()
elif self.location and self.publisher and self.offer and self.sku:
self.results['ansible_facts']['azure_vmimages'] = self.list_images()
elif self.location and self.publisher:
self.results['ansible_facts']['azure_vmimages'] = self.list_offers()
elif self.location:
self.results['ansible_facts']['azure_vmimages'] = self.list_publishers()
return self.results
def get_item(self):
item = None
result = []
try:
item = self.compute_client.virtual_machine_images.get(self.location,
self.publisher,
self.offer,
self.sku,
self.version)
except CloudError:
pass
if item:
result = [self.serialize_obj(item, 'VirtualMachineImage', enum_modules=AZURE_ENUM_MODULES)]
return result
def list_images(self):
response = None
results = []
try:
response = self.compute_client.virtual_machine_images.list(self.location,
self.publisher,
self.offer,
self.sku,)
except CloudError:
pass
except Exception as exc:
self.fail("Failed to list images: {0}".format(str(exc)))
if response:
for item in response:
results.append(self.serialize_obj(item, 'VirtualMachineImageResource',
enum_modules=AZURE_ENUM_MODULES))
return results
def list_offers(self):
response = None
results = []
try:
response = self.compute_client.virtual_machine_images.list_offers(self.location,
self.publisher)
except CloudError:
pass
except Exception as exc:
self.fail("Failed to list offers: {0}".format(str(exc)))
if response:
for item in response:
results.append(self.serialize_obj(item, 'VirtualMachineImageResource',
enum_modules=AZURE_ENUM_MODULES))
return results
def list_publishers(self):
response = None
results = []
try:
response = self.compute_client.virtual_machine_images.list_publishers(self.location)
except CloudError:
pass
except Exception as exc:
self.fail("Failed to list publishers: {0}".format(str(exc)))
if response:
for item in response:
results.append(self.serialize_obj(item, 'VirtualMachineImageResource',
enum_modules=AZURE_ENUM_MODULES))
return results
def main():
AzureRMVirtualMachineImageFacts()
if __name__ == '__main__':
main()
